1x01 Beer

Series Premiere

1x01 Beer

  • 2010-05-31T12:30:00Z30m

Draw a cold one at NYC's The Pony Bar, an American Craft Beer Bar, to find out everything you wanted to know about beer. Justin Philips proves that wine's not the only beverage you can pair with sophisticated food. Plus, two avid homebrewers show us how to DIY.

1x02 Tequila

1x02 Tequila

  • 2010-05-31T12:30:00Z30m

Discover a tequila bar- Mayahuel, and meet tequila expert Phil Ward mix up wild tequila cocktails, tasty tequila pairings and some crazy twists on everyone's favorite tequila cocktail, the margarita. Luis Gonzales cooks up braised ribs with a mezcal glaze, and a tequila tuna tartare. Plus check out a visit to the Tequila Library where you can check out tequila instead of books.

1x07 Whiskey

1x07 Whiskey

  • 2010-08-15T12:30:00Z30m

What better place to talk about whiskey than the legendary 21 Club in New York City? For this journey, Darryl Robinson has enlisted the help of whiskey expert and master mixologist Allen Katz to guide us from a traditional Scotch Whiskey to the all-American bourbon. Then we are pairing up some of Chef John Greeley's whiskey inspired dishes to go with Allen's innovative cocktails. And you won't want to miss a trip to Bond Street restaurant, where Japanese whiskey expert Gardner Dunn carves his own ice and makes an Old Fashioned cocktail with an Asian twist.

1x09 Red Wine

1x09 Red Wine

  • 2010-08-29T12:30:00Z30m

Red Wine is demystified at top restaurants across the country along with the top experts! Meet author Mark Oldman at NY's Industria Argentina and uncork the basics of pinot noir, merlot, and cabernet. And don't miss the unique and clever tricks Brian Duncan of Bin 36 in Chicago shares for translating wine terms while pouring some of the best reds around. Plus there's delicious food: a taste of Spain with a rich paella, an extraordinary rack of lamb sauced with Argentinean Malbec, gooey baked cheese, and Darryl's most refreshing red wine cocktails.
